Huawei Nova 7 SE 5G Malaysia: Everything you need to know

Huawei Malaysia has officially revealed its availability details for the Nova 7 SE. This is currently the most affordable new 5G smartphone in Malaysia that’s priced under RM1,500.

Pricing and availability

Below is the official pricing of the Huawei Nova 7 SE 5G in Malaysia:

8GB RAM + 128GB storage – RM1,499

The device comes in 3 colours – Space Silver, Crush Green and Midsummer Purple. It will be available from the 19th of June 2020 at the Huawei online store as well as Huawei Experience Stores nationwide.

As a launch promo, Huawei is offering free gifts and rewards that are worth up to RM1,256. This includes a Huawei Band 4, Nova casing, 3 months access to Huawei Video (dimsum), 6 months access to Huawei Book, 12 months 15GB Huawei Cloud Storage and Member centre rewards worth up to RM1,000.

Huawei is also offering additional free gifts during the Huawei AppGallery Carnival 2020. On top of that, you’ll also stand a chance to win 1 out of 3 Proton X70 that are given away as a lucky draw during the Huawei AppGallery Carnival.

Hardware Specs

The Huawei Nova 7 SE is Huawei’s new mid-range smartphone that supports 5G connectivity. It comes with a 6.5″ Full HD+ IPS display and it runs on a Kirin 820 processor.

The device gets a quad-camera setup at the rear that consists of a 64MP main camera, an 8MP ultra-wide-angle shooter, a 2MP macro camera and a 2MP depth sensor. Meanwhile, the front punch-hole houses a 16MP selfie camera. With MeeTime, it supports 1080p video calls, screen sharing and beauty mode with compatible Huawei smartphones.

Powering the device is a 4,000mAh battery that supports 40W SuperCharge via USB-C. It is rated to provide a 70% charge within just 30 minutes. Overall, it weighs 189 grams and Huawei says it’s lighter than your makeup.

Do note that the device runs on Huawei Mobile Services and that means it doesn’t come with Google apps and services pre-installed. To discover and download apps, it comes with Huawei’s AppGallery.
